New to the pool  Cheesy Cheesy
figured, I will point my little 14TH/S to a small pool, and support the BTC decentralization Smiley
As for pay outs, not sure how it works, but i plan to stay with KANO
You get a reward per block found based on your % of the last 5Nd of work everyone did.
(See Help->Payouts)

.
.
.

Payouts each block are if your reward is over dust (0.0001 BTC)
A 14TH/s miner is well above dust but at the start of your 5Nd 'ramp' there might be a dust reward.

Dust gathers into dust bunnies under the bed and awaits the new accounting system completion.
